Thursday night’s TV ratings are in.  Here’s a brief look at the highlights:

  • Fans were eager to see Tina Fey’s Liz Lemon tie the knot, as the wedding-centric episode of 30 Rock scored a 1.3 rating and 3.61 million viewers, up 8% from its last original episode’s 1.2 rating.
  • ABC’s soap Scandal bounced back with a season high 2.2 rating and 6.67 million viewers, up 10% from its last new episode’s 2.0 rating.
  • Sadly, Parks and Recreation dropped to a series low 1.4 rating in the 18-49 demo and 3.04 million viewers.  That’s down 18% from its last new episode’s 1.7 rating.
  • Also hitting a series low was The Office with a 1.9 rating and 3.89 million viewers, dropping 10% from its last original episode’s 2.1 rating.

ABC

  • The now-cancelled Last Resort will continue to air the rest of its episodes, though this week’s installment hit a series low 1.0 rating and 5.2 million viewers for a drop of 17% from its last new episode’s 1.2 rating.
  • Also getting in on the season low business was Grey’s Anatomy, which hit a 3.0 rating in the demo and 8.7 million viewers versus its last new episode’s 3.2 rating.
  • Surprisingly, Scandal was the big gainer on ABC as it hit a season high 2.2 rating and 6.67 million viewers.  That’s up 10% from its last original episode’s 2.0 rating.

FOX

  • Glee garnered a 2.2 rating and 5.8 million viewers, up 47% over its 1.5 rating earned on Thanksgiving.

The CW

  • The CW gave the networks a run for their money, as The Vampire Diaries hit a 1.5 rating and 3.2 million viewers versus its last new episode’s 1.3 rating.
  • Beauty and the Beast was also up, hitting a 0.8 rating and 2.15 million viewers for a rise of 33% from its last original episode’s 0.6 rating.
